Milk Black Carbon works against the narratives of dispossession and survival that mark the contemporary experience of many indigenous people, and Inuit in particular. In this collection, autobiographical details - motherhood, marriage, extended family and its geographical context in the rapidly changing arctic - negotiate arbitrary landscapes of our perplexing frontiers through fragmentation and interpretation of conventional lyric expectations.
Author: Joan Naviyuk Kane
Binding Type: Paperback
Publisher: University of Pittsburgh Press
Published: 01/25/2017
Series: Pitt Poetry
Pages: 72
Weight: 0.25lbs
Size: 8.90h x 5.90w x 0.30d
ISBN: 9780822964513
